嵌入式Linux是Linux在嵌入式计算机系统中的应用,例如移动电话,个人数字助理,媒体播放器,机顶盒和其他消费电子设备,网络设备,机器控制,工业自动化,导航设备和医疗仪器。
我正在尝试使用 iMX8MP 为我的自定义板移植基于 88w8987 的 wifi/bt 调制解调器。我已经交叉编译了固件并生成了相关的目标文件。我的问题是如何将这些文件添加到...
为 RK3128 嵌入式 Linux 设备启用 UART TTY
背景 我有一个使用 U-Boot 引导加载程序的嵌入式 Android 设备。该系统还使用Busybox套件。 我可以通过 UART 端口访问 U-Boot shell,并且可以转储、修改...
我正在尝试在 ftrace 中启用“功能”跟踪器 https://lwn.net/Articles/290277/ https://lwn.net/Articles/548894/ https://access.redhat.com/documentation/en-us/
只是寻找有关如何在二进制文件中查找隐藏文本(基本上是 1 个或多个电子邮件 ID)的任何指针(提示)?该文件是针对 ELF Linux 目标编译的。理想情况下,我愿意
我有一个带有一些敏感内存的进程,这些内存绝不能写入磁盘。 我还有一个要求,我需要核心转储来满足客户的首次数据捕获要求。 是否
我正在构建一个 Linux 内核模块,它需要读取 HID 设备,以使用 RPC 通信将数据发送到虚拟机管理程序。这些假设是必要的,因为我正在嵌入式 Linux 中工作并且......
如何添加用户以用户身份而不是 root Yocto 项目 sama5d27 板登录
我正在使用 sama5d27 som1 ek1 板,并使用 yocto 项目为其构建 Linux 内核。我打开minicom并启动系统。我想从图像功能中删除调试调整,但我现在必须设置
我可以使用 Buildroot,从 HPS 上的 Linux(SoC FPGA 中的 ARM 内核)使用固件对 Altera/Intel Cyclone V SoC FPGA 的 FPGA 部分进行编程。 我正在使用设备树覆盖来编写原始...
我正在开发 BeagleBone Black(在其上运行 Debian 3.8.13)。我想在启动时运行 QT GUI 应用程序(登录后在屏幕上显示 GUI)。 我可以通过
我有一个可以在嵌入式Linux(在地震数字化仪上)上的bash命令中使用的小Python工具。在我的示例中,该工具调用传感器(在本例中为电压传感器),然后输出
我正在使用 Code Composer Studio 和 C 语言开发 Tiva TM4C1294 我想创建一个计时器函数并使用它,而不是在下面的代码块中使用延迟函数。例如,当我
我们有一块嵌入式板,配有 iMX8M-Plus 处理器和 Linux v5.4.161。该板有一条 PCIe 总线,该总线连接到 FPGA。当我们给开发板加电时,FPGA还没有配置...
我正在尝试使用 Code Composer Studio 编写 tiva c 系列 tm4c1294,操作系统是 Linux Ubuntu 20.04。当我运行其中一个示例时,我遇到以下错误: gmake[1]: *** [led.out] 错误...
BeagleBone Black 显示错误“软件包‘cmake’没有安装候选”
当我尝试在 BeagleBone Black 板上安装 cmake 时。我正在使用 Debian Buster IoT 映像 2020-04-06 sudo apt-get 安装 cmake 我收到以下错误。有关更多详细信息,这是我的日志: debian@
sched_setschedule 在“aarch64-linux-musl-g++”上失败
我在 Android 上设置调度策略的一段代码遇到了运行时问题。代码使用“aarch64-linux-androideabi21-clang++”成功编译并运行,...
我正在使用 Raspberry PI Compute Module 4 进行开发。我的 RPI-cm4 具有板载 EMMC 8GB 内存。我们遵循以下布局 对于引导加载程序,我们使用 u-boot。 U-Boot> mmc 列表 mmcnr@7e3000...
我正在尝试实现新的linux gpio api。使用 v1 api,我能够确认此代码是否有效: // req 是更大代码的一部分 struct gpiohandle_request lreq; memset(lreq.default_value...
Linux simple-framebuffer 未被内核检测到
我正在尝试让简单的帧缓冲区在Linux中工作,这样我就可以使用系统RAM中的一个区域作为帧缓冲区。 我在 RISCV 系统上运行内核 5.10.7。 到目前为止,我已经启用了帧缓冲区
GStreamer 1.14.4 使用 Buildroot 构建错误
我在构建 GStreamer 1.14.4 时遇到以下错误: /build/gstreamer1-1.14.4/libs/gst/controller » CC libgstcontroller_1.0_la-controller-enumtypes.lo 控制器枚举类型.c:6:1: ...
为了使用自定义设备树,我做了以下安排: 为了消除可能的设备树语法错误,我刚刚下载了原始 dts 文件并将其名称更改为 custom-bananapro.dt...